Output ed30d2d2bfb7e679d750c7e794bed8f47cf9923004179d1ff3fc69f64fefbb37:0

value
103107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8d97824a950d31a2dae2f30e5d91b0e17892e6 OP_EQUAL
address
37JUmDcogYdCtpMoY2XCyB75TS8pwva8Rt
transaction
ed30d2d2bfb7e679d750c7e794bed8f47cf9923004179d1ff3fc69f64fefbb37
confirmations
168563
spent
true